Preparation of Nanometer Calcium Carbonate by Multistage Spray Carbonation

Abstract: The preparation process of nanometer calcium carbonate(CaCO3) by multistage spray carbonation was studied. The effects of the conditions of spray carbonation and additive dosage on the average particle size of nanometer CaCO3 were discussed systematically. The primary particle size of carbonated sediment was about 30nm by vacuum desiccation. Then the active nanometer CaCO3 particles ranged from 30nm to 40nm were obtained by means of surfaction.

Key words: nanometer calcium carbonate, multistage spray carbonation, particle size, mass transfer coefficient
